- Abstract
- Power aware scheduling problem has been a recent issue in cluster systems not only for operational cost due to electricity cost but also for system reliability In this paper we provide SLA based scheduling algorithms for bag of tasks applications with deadline constraints on power aware cluster systems The scheduling objective is to minimize power consumption as long as the system provides the service levels of users A bag of tasks application should finish all the sub tasks before the deadline as the service level We provide the power aware scheduling algorithms for both time shared and space shared resource sharing policies The simulation results show that the proposed algorithms reduce much power consumption compared to static voltage schemes
